Difficulties of Extreme Temperatures
Extreme temperatures can position significant challenges for roof covering installation. If you're working in severe warm, products like asphalt roof shingles can come to be overly pliable, making them tough to place accurately. You may discover that the adhesive used for roof covering products does not bond effectively, leading to possible problems down the line.
On the flip side, when temperature levels drop, materials can become brittle. This brittleness can trigger roof shingles to split or break during setup, jeopardizing the honesty of your roofing system.
In addition, extreme cold can decrease the curing process of adhesives and sealants, making it harder for them to establish appropriately. You may need to wait longer before applying additional layers or completing the project.
To minimize these obstacles, you should prepare your installation timing meticulously. Early morning or late afternoon can be suitable throughout warm days, while selecting milder days is essential in the cold weather.
